What is a Factory Reset?

A factory reset, also known as a hard reset or master reset, restores a device to its original factory settings. This process erases all personal data, apps, settings, and files, returning the device to the state it was in when first purchased. It is a crucial step before selling or trading in your device to ensure your personal information remains private and your device is clean for the next user.

Why Perform a Factory Reset Before Trade-In?

  • Protect Your Privacy: Removing personal data prevents identity theft and protects sensitive information.
  • Increase Trade-In Value: Devices that are clean and reset are more appealing to buyers and trade-in programs, often fetching better prices.
  • Ensure Device Functionality: Resetting can resolve minor software issues, making the device more attractive and functional for the next user.
  • Comply with Trade-In Policies: Many programs require a factory reset before accepting a device.

Steps to Perform a Factory Reset

Each device has a different process for resetting. Here are general steps for common devices:

For iPhones and iPads

  • Back up your data to iCloud or your computer.
  • Go to Settings > General > Transfer or Reset iPhone > Erase All Content and Settings.
  • Enter your Apple ID password if prompted.
  • Confirm and wait for the device to erase.

For Android Devices

  • Back up your data to Google Drive or another service.
  • Go to Settings > System > Reset options > Erase all data (factory reset).
  • Confirm your choice and wait for the reset to complete.

Additional Tips for a Smooth Trade-In

  • Remove any SIM or SD cards before performing the reset.
  • Charge your device fully to avoid interruptions during the reset process.
  • Clean your device physically to improve its appearance.
  • Gather accessories, original boxes, and receipts if available, to enhance trade-in value.
